The motivations behind these cheats are layered. On the surface, they appear purely utilitarian: players wanted unlimited “FIFA Coins” to buy Cristiano Ronaldo or Lionel Messi without the grind of hundreds of matches. However, a deeper psychological driver is the desire for mastery over a closed system. In FIFA 18 ’s Career Mode—an offline, single-player experience—cheating harms no other human opponent. Here, altering the ROM becomes a form of expressive play. A player might edit a lower-league team’s budget to simulate a billionaire takeover, or boost a teenage prospect’s potential to 99 overall, crafting a personalized fantasy league. This is not cheating in the competitive sense but rather “modding” by another name. The Nintendo Switch, a device celebrated for its flexibility (docked or handheld, console or portable), ironically became a prison for such creativity due to Nintendo’s stringent software lockdown. Thus, cracking the ROM was an act of liberation—a way for users to assert control over a game that, in their view, had artificially limited their enjoyment.

For those without a modded console, you can use these glitches to gain advantages: Career Mode Unlimited Money
At the end of a season, allocate your remaining transfer budget to wages by giving an existing player a massive contract. In the next season, renegotiate that same player’s contract down to a realistic wage to free up the surplus as transfer funds.

Released on September 29, 2017, FIFA 18 was a special version built specifically for Nintendo’s hybrid console. Unlike the watered-down titles of the past, FIFA 18 on Switch was a "proper FIFA" experience, including core modes like Career Mode, FUT, and Local Seasons. While it didn't run on EA's Frostbite Engine, it provided a 60fps portable football experience that was a massive step up from previous handheld FIFA games.
